I am working on designing some light gage for a college addition. I have a 28 t. tall x 12 ft. wide storefront window. It is surrounded on three sides with CMU. At the top, the Arch/Eor is showing a light gage assembly. i put a note on my shops drawing indicating that I assumed the window is spanning horizontally (why wouldn't it?) The Arch has come back and indicated that it is designed to span vertically. I can't believe this is true and, if it was, would there not be significant deflection compatibility issues at the jambs where it runs next to the CMU?
